MAKING THE ARMY TEAM C4ISR MOVE A SEAMLESS TRANSITION
October 23, 2008
ABERDEEN, Md., Oct. 23 -- Aberdeen Proving Ground released the following issue of APG News:

The deputy commander (forward) for the U.S. Army Communications and Electronics Command Lifecycle Management Command has the task of leading Army Team U.S. Army Command, Control, Communications, Computers, Intelligence, Surveillance and Reconnaissance Forward as the organization makes the transition from Fort Monmouth, N.J., to Aberdeen Proving Ground.
